5 Chronic Disease Management

6 Definition of Chronic Condition A chronic medical condition is one that has been or is likely to be present for six months or longer, including but not limited to, asthma, cancer, cardiovascular disease, diabetes, musculoskeletal conditions and stroke.

7 Aim of the Chronic Disease Management (CDM) program Coordination of services and treatments Proactive focus Active participation by patient Multidisciplinary team care approach

8 Patient eligibility for CDM Determined by the patients usual GP GPMP Patient must have a chronic or terminal condition and would benefit from a structured care approach - MBS Item 721 TCA - Patients must have a chronic or terminal condition with complex care needs, requiring ongoing care from a multidisciplinary team that being at least 3 health or care providers from different disciplines, one of which is the GP - MBS Item 723

9 Other Medicare CDM service Items GPMP & TCA Review - MBS Item 732 can be claimed X 2 on the same day if both GPMP & TCA were reviewed (must be annotated) MBS Item review or contribute to a multidisciplinary care plan prepared by another health or care provider MBS Item 731- contribution or review of a multidisciplinary care plan for a resident of a RACF where the plan was developed by the facility

11 Patient exclusions Medicare Provider Enquiry Line Ring to check if patient is eligible for care planning MBS Item payment before commencing a care plan or a review can check eligibility of up to 7 patients per call Minimal claiming intervals apply except when exceptional circumstances apply

12 Care plan content Relevant conditions and health care needs Treatment and services Management goals & actions agreed to by patient Review date

13 GPMP Process Explanation of care planning process, consent & agreement by patient to participate Comprehensive care plan documented in a template Copy provided to patient and saved in patient medical record Generate recall/reminder for periodic review of goals and actions

14 TCA Process Patient consent for TCA and sharing of information with multidisciplinary team Collaboration with a team of 2 or more health or care providers Collaborate with team to determine goals, treatments and services Copy of care plan to team and patient Review date documented & generate recall/reminder

15 What is meant by collaboration? What does ongoing involvement with the patient mean? Ongoing involvement means provider contact must be based on more than a one off consultation

16 Access to Allied health services via TCA Directly related to the patients condition and identified in the TCA 5 rebated individual AHP services per calendar year 8 rebated group AHP sessions per calendar year- for patients with Diabetes - can be accessed via GPMP only

19 Reviewing GPMP/TCA - Item 732 GPMP Changes must be documented Copy of updated plan with new review date for patient TCA Changes must be documented Collaboration with the providers on progress against the goals Copy of updated plan with new review date for patient & TCA providers

20 Who can assist the GP? Practice nurse, Aboriginal & Torres Strait Islander Health Practitioner, Aboriginal Health Worker or other health professional GP must review and confirm assessments and arrangements and see patient when CDM Items are billed

21 Role of the practice nurse The practice nurse assists the GP with any of the following: Assessment, identification of patient needs, patient metrics ID patient needs and assistance with goal setting Arrangements for services / communicating with multidisciplinary team Support and education Management of reviews Data management & record keeping

22 Practice nurse MBS Item MBS Item x 5 per calendar year for monitoring /support provided to a patient with a chronic condition who has a GPMP and/or TCA in place Provided under the supervision of the GP, however GP does NOT have to see patient on the day

23 Care Planning Templates Care Planning templates (generic or for specific chronic diseases) feature in most clinical software Peak Bodies also provide care planning templates (eg Health Foundation, Asthma Council, Arthritis Foundation, Diabetes Aust etc) Modify templates to suit practice needs Must follow specific instructions to import a template so specific patient data auto populates GPMP & TCA can be one combined document

24 Home Medicine Review (HMR) Item 900 Patient eligibility Frequency is every 24 months unless exceptional circumstances exist (must document) GP refers patient for a medication review to an accredited pharmacist, who provides a report back to the GP Review of pharmacist report by GP and implementation of findings

25 Inclusion of National Cancer Screening reminders in care plans Include reminder in care plan for age specific cancer screening actions National Bowel Cancer Screening Program changing from 5 to 2 yearly by 2019 for yo Females HPV Cervical Cancer Screening 5 yearly for yo from May 2017 Breast Cancer Screening 2 yearly for yo

26 Removal of same day billing Effective from November 2014 Cannot claim Standard Consultation Item and CDM Item on the same day
